In the only contested race in Plymouth’s town elections, Russ Tonkin was elected to the Plymouth Selectboard for a three-year term. The final count was 100 votes for Russ Tonkin and 95 for Larry Lynds, who had served for many years on the Selectboard, most recently as a replacement for Todd Blanchard who stepped down before the end of his term.
The Plymouth Election Results were as follows:
Moderator: Thomas Harris*
Delinquent Tax Collector: Kathleen Billings
Selectperson: Russ Tonkin
Grand Juror: William Jarvi
Lister: Michelle Pingree
Town Agent: William Jarvi
Auditor: Carol Coyne
Cemetery Commissioner: Thomas Brown
Trustee of Public Funds: Margaret Tucker
School Director: Julie Dupont
School District Clerk: Barbara Rabtoy
School Moderator: Thomas Harris*
School Director: Keeley Crossman*
First Constable: Justus Pingree
Second Constable: Ted Hall*
* Write-in Candidates
In the Republican presidential primary contest, Mitt Romney was the local winner, with 43% of the votes. Ron Paul was second with 27% of the votes and Rick Santorum had 21% of the votes. Newt Gingrich had 8% of the votes.
